## Approvals: Quillprint PDF Invoice Renderer

Quick note for the weekly sync: any change to the Quillprint renderer's layout engine now needs an approval before merge. We got bitten last month when a font-fallback tweak shifted totals off the page for Northgale Coffee's invoices, and nobody caught it until billing day. So: template changes, margin math, and anything touching the currency formatter all go through review. Small copy fixes are exempt. Questions go to the renderer channel first. The final sign-off rests with one person.

named custodian: Brivan Eliath Quenox Frador

The Corvane hot-reload daemon watches the config bus under a dedicated service account. If that account lapses, reloads silently stop and nodes drift on stale configuration, which is how last month's mismatch happened. Recovery procedure: freeze config pushes, confirm all nodes report the same revision, then restore the account from the sealed recovery bundle on the ops host. Restoring the bundle prompts once for the recovery passphrase before re-enabling the watcher. That passphrase is listed on the following line.

recovery phrase for fajep-yaweg: gilath-sorox-wenius-rusdor-keliel-zorius

Notes — Tumblebin locker access flow. Current flow: resident taps code, locker opens, laundry bag scanned on pickup. Issues raised: codes expire at midnight, confusing for overnight drop-offs; extend to 36h. Courier override PIN reused across sites — must rotate per location. New contractor: don't touch the firmware queue; staging lockers at the Harrowgate pilot site only. Access logs stay on for audit, no exceptions. Next review in two weeks. All access-flow questions and change approvals go through the owner listed below.

account owner for bawip-tahag: Raleth Quenok

Loading dock deliveries at Marlow House are accepted 07:00–15:30, Monday to Friday only. No exceptions without prior sign-off from Facilities. Couriers must not be buzzed through the main lobby; direct all deliveries to Dock B on Fenner Lane. After 15:30, refuse acceptance and log the attempt in the dock register. Weekend deliveries require written approval from the Ventrix Logistics desk two days ahead. To open the dock roller door for approved arrivals, use the code below.

turnstile pass: bdg-YPPQB-52010